Aims: This study aimed to evaluate in vitro antioxidant capacity of olive leaf extract (OLE), Olea europaea L., and its protective effect on peroxyl radical-induced oxidative damage in human erythrocytes. Main methods: The OLE was evaluated by the following assays: i) total phenolic and flavonoid content; ii) oleuropein content; iii) Ferric reducing antioxidant power (FRAP); iv) antioxidant activity against ABTS(center dot+) , DPPH center dot and reactive oxygen and nitrogen species: superoxide anion (O-2(center dot-)), hypochlorous acid (HOCl) and nitric oxide (NO center dot) and v) protective effect on peroxyl radical-induced oxidative damages in human erythrocytes as hemolysis, thiobarbituric acid reactive substances (TBARS) formation and oxyhemoglobin oxidation. Key findings: Total phenolic and flavonoid contents were 131.7 +/- 9.4 mg gallic acid equivalents/g dry weight (dw) and 19.4 +/- 1.3 mg quercetin equivalents/g dw, respectively. Oleuropein content was 25.5 +/- 5.2 mg/g dw. FRAP analysis was 281.8 +/- 22.8 mg trolox equivalent/g dw and OLE inhibited ABTS(center dot+) (50% effective concentration (EC50) = 16.1 +/- 1.2 mu g/mL) and DPPH center dot (EC50 = 13.8 +/- 0.8 mu g/mL). The extract demonstrated effective ability to scavenge O-2(center dot-) (EC5(0) = 52.6 +/- 2.1 mu g/mL), NO center dot (EC50 = 48.4 +/- 6.8 mu g/mL) and HOCl (EC50 = 714.1 +/- 31.4 mu g/mL). The extract inhibited peroxyl radical-induced hemolysis (EC50 = 11.5 +/- 1.5 mu g/mL), TBARS formation (EC50 = 38.0 +/- 11.7 mu g/mL) and hemoglobin oxidation (EC50 = 186.3 +/- 29.7 mu g/mL) in erythrocytes. Significance: OLE is an important source of natural antioxidants; it has effective antioxidant activity against different reactive species and protects human erythrocytes against oxidative damage.
